#C412BD Hex color

#C412BD

The hexadecimal color code #C412BD corresponds to the code RGB( 196, 18, 189 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,77 level), green (at 0,07 level) and blue (at 0,74 level). Its brightness is 41% and its saturation is 83%. It is composed of red at 48%, green at 4% and blue at 46%.
